Police arrest Kailaiya Mayor Yadav for distributing rotten lentils



BARA: Police have arrested Kailya Sub- Metropolitan City Mayor Rajesh Raya Yadav alleging him for distributing rancid lentils in the name of relief package.

Police have initiated investigation and has been interrogating Mayor Yadav about the incident, SP Krishna Pangeni at District Police Office, Bara said.

Earlier, police had arrested 5 ward chairmen, 3 employees and one broker supplying lentils.

Bara Administration Office had on April 11 sealed Yadav Cold Store at ward no 7 of the sub-metropolitan after the rancid lentils were found.

The administration had recovered 380 sacks of lentils.
